Each Citrus Salt sachet delivers 1000 mg of sodium from sodium chloride, the primary mineral your body loses through sweat and the one most directly responsible for fluid retention, blood volume, nerve impulse transmission, and the osmotic gradient that determines whether water enters your cells or passes through to your bladder. 200 mg potassium from potassium chloride supports muscle contraction, cardiac rhythm, and cellular membrane potential. 60 mg magnesium from magnesium malate, a highly bioavailable chelated form, contributes to normal muscle function, normal psychological function, electrolyte balance, and the reduction of tiredness and fatigue. Zero sugar. Zero artificial sweeteners. Zero artificial colours or flavours. Sweetened with stevia leaf extract. Mix one sachet with 500 ml of water, still or sparkling. Adjust water volume to taste: more water for lighter flavour, less for a stronger citrus hit. First thing in the morning is ideal to replenish overnight sodium and fluid losses. Before, during, or after training to replace exercise-induced electrolyte depletion. During fasting windows to maintain mineral balance without breaking the fast. In the afternoon when energy and focus dip. Try with sparkling water and a lime wedge for a zero-sugar citrus mocktail. One to two sachets daily for most active individuals. Those training intensely, sweating heavily, or following strict low-carb protocols may benefit from two to three sachets daily. Consult your doctor if you have hypertension or kidney disease before supplementing with high-sodium products. Store in a cool, dry place.

What's inside

Ingredients

View full ingredient list

Sodium Chloride (Salt), Acidity Regulator (Citric Acid), Potassium Chloride, Magnesium Malate, Natural Lemon and Lime Flavours, Sweetener (Steviol Glycosides) Six ingredients. No sugar. No maltodextrin. No artificial sweeteners, colours, or preservatives.
